logo

Output 9be92bdd593c14a886cd8f1f2faeeb58d6fd90d2e2aaedecb3b81a0657da6a43:2

value
11493683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688e573ab2795868781a58702d1eef069e102edc OP_EQUAL
address
3BDriW5ENkCSKtbcBMuQTHTTs85VsPXubB
transaction
9be92bdd593c14a886cd8f1f2faeeb58d6fd90d2e2aaedecb3b81a0657da6a43